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)1. Just how much can a 20ft container hold?
A standard 20ft container can hold approximately 1,172 cubic feet of cargo, with a maximum payload capacity of about 52,910 pounds (24,000 kg).
2. Can I modify a 20ft container?
Yes, 20ft containers can be customized for various purposes, consisting of windows, doors, insulation, and electrical setups. Many business offer adjustment services to suit specific needs.
3. How much does a 20ft container cost?
The expense of a 20ft container can differ widely based upon condition (new or utilized), type (requirement, high cube, cooled), and area. Generally, costs vary from ₤ 1,500 to ₤ 5,000 for a used standard container.
